I'm looking to find the original CANADIAN MSRP for a 05 SE Fatboy. I'm about ready to purchase an extremely sweet looking 05 just wanted to know if the price is in the ballpark. $25,000 cdn with lifetime powertrain warranty. Wanted to know what this bike originally sold for here in Canada. 3700 miles. Any help would be appreciated.
-
I am not sure on the CDN side, Seems a bit high to me though. I got my 2006 with 240 miles on it last fall for 24,500.00 USD
-
msrp in US was $27,995 - California was $28,095

2005 Harley-Davidson FLSTFSE SE FatBoy
2-Cylinder
4-Stroke
1690cc
Suggested Retail Value $22375* The Kelley Blue Book Suggested Retail Value is representative of dealers' asking prices and is the starting point for negotiation between a consumer and a dealer. This Suggested Retail Value assumes that the unit has been fully reconditioned and is in excellent condition. Mileage/condition and additional equipment may have a substantial impact on the value shown above. This value also takes into account the dealers' profit, costs for advertising, sales commissions and other costs of doing business. The final sale price will likely be less depending on the unit's actual condition, popularity, type of warranty offered and local market conditions.
